Technical Specifications That Matter
Let's break down what makes these capacitors special:
| Parameter | Traditional Battery | Super Capacitor |
|---|---|---|
| Charge Time | 1-5 hours | 1-30 seconds |
| Cycle Life | 500-2000 | 1,000,000+ |
| Operating Temp | -20°C to 60°C | -40°C to 85°C |

Choosing the Right Solution
Not all capacitors are created equal. Here's what professionals look for:
- ESR (Equivalent Series Resistance) below 3mΩ
- Leakage current less than 0.5mA
- IP67 or higher protection rating

FAQ: Quick Answers to Common Questions
Q: How long do these capacitors typically last? A: Most industrial-grade units last 10-15 years with proper installation.
Q: Can they replace batteries entirely? A: They work best in combination with batteries - think of them as the sprinter to batteries' marathon runner.
